This is tricky as AFC says that rrp's apply to "qualified" MTO's and some trusts are arguing this starts at MTO3. However no union has accepted this argument yet AFAIK and I would have said that qualified means not ATO or student. That said, what profile have they matched you to to get band 4? the only one I can find is "Medical Engineering Technician (Entry Level)" and if you've been doing the job long enough to reach the top of the scale then you shouldn't be at "entry level"
